Bladder Pain Syndrome

open access: yesMedical Clinics of North America, 2011
Bladder pain syndrome is a deceptively intricate symptom complex that is diagnosed on the basis of chronic pelvic pain, pressure, or discomfort perceived to be related to the urinary bladder, accompanied by at least one other urinary symptom. It is a diagnosis of exclusion in a patient who has experienced the symptoms for at least 6 weeks in the ...

BLADDER PAIN SYNDROME. Bladder pain syndrome (BPS), often associated with other pelvic pain syndromes, is defined as perceived chronic pain or discomfort related to the bladder, associated with other urinary symptoms such as pollakiuria or a constant urge to urinate, in the absence of organic pathology. It more often affects women.

Bladder pain syndrome and pregnancy

European Journal of Obstetrics & Gynecology and Reproductive Biology, 2023
Bladder pain syndrome (BPS) is a poorly understood condition. In pregnancy, lower urinary tract symptoms and pain are common, but the possibility of BPS is rarely considered and almost never explored. The consequences of BPS on pregnancy and vice versa are poorly understood, and management options appear to be limited.
